Would Bill Gates be sent packing?
Bloomsberg is running a story about how the UK would refuse entry to Bill Gates, should he choose to move to Britain, now that he's given up work. It appears he would not qualify to live in the UK under the rules of the Government's new Tier 1 (General) immigration category. It's because doesn't hold a degree! The same thing goes for Michael Dell, should he decide to join Bill in early retirement.
